Transaction 58fa9939afd8b59c671a40d7651a3182ff71d6d40e244d2838bd03151ba33fed
1 Input
1 Output
-
58fa9939afd8b59c671a40d7651a3182ff71d6d40e244d2838bd03151ba33fed:0
- value
- 1250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e8f509b88bb667aa857ee875f41f92d4b9aaa9b6314741568d988ca9a3ef5325
- address
- bc1par6snwytken64pt7ap6lg8uj6ju642dkx9r5z45dnzx2ngl02vjspquhs0